Concept Clarification: When it comes to investing in Tamil Nadu, it is essential to clarify a few key concepts to make informed decisions. First, understanding the risk-return tradeoff is crucial. Different investment options come with varying levels of risk and return potential. High-risk investments, such as investing in startups, may offer high returns but also come with a higher chance of losses. On the other hand, conservative investments like government bonds provide lower returns but come with lower risk. Secondly, diversification is key to managing risk in investments. By spreading capital across different asset classes, sectors, and geographies, investors can reduce the impact of adverse events on their overall portfolio. Diversification helps in balancing out the risks and rewards of different investments and can lead to a more stable and resilient investment portfolio. Emotions in Investing: Emotions play a significant role in investment decisions and can often lead to irrational behavior. Greed, fear, overconfidence, and panic are common emotions that can cloud judgment and lead to impulsive investment decisions. It is essential for investors in Tamil Nadu to manage their emotions effectively to avoid making costly mistakes. One way to manage emotions in investing is to have a well-thought-out investment plan and stick to it. Setting clear investment goals, risk tolerance, and investment horizon can help investors stay focused on the long-term objectives and avoid making emotional decisions based on short-term market fluctuations.
